About this home
Public Remarks: Cozy vibes only! This wonderfully maintained Appleton Highlands ranch is now ready for its next lucky owner. Living and entertaining spaces, renovated bath and kitchen, bones for a true cedar planked sauna, and a large backyard deck with built in swing. Basement build out is fully cedar and gives access to a finished half bath. There is character around every corner! The list of inclusions alone is worth a look. Full kitchen appliance package, washer, dryer, and a list of furnishings from dressers and bar stools to extra fridges and storage sheds! Highlands Elementary School and Kiwanis Park just blocks away. Centrally located with easy access to the Northland shopping center and just about anything you may need.

R-1B
Single-Family District
The R-1B district is intended to provide for and maintain residential areas characterized predominately by single-family, detached dwellings on medium sized lots while protecting residential neighborhoods from the intrusion of incompatible non-residential uses.
